What is an ETL database developer?

An ETL Database Developer is a specialized IT professional responsible for designing, developing, and maintaining processes that extract data from various sources, transform it into a usable format, and load it into databases or data warehouses. They work with ETL tools, scripting languages, and database technologies to ensure data integrity, quality, and efficient data workflows. ETL Database Developers play a key role in supporting business intelligence, analytics, and reporting by ensuring that accurate and timely data is available for decision-making.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an ETL database developer?

To thrive as an ETL Database Developer, you need strong expertise in database design, SQL, data modeling, and ETL (Extract, Transform, Load) processes, typically supported by a degree in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with ETL tools like Informatica, Talend, or Microsoft SSIS, as well as experience with various database management systems, are commonly required. Analytical thinking, attention to detail, and effective problem-solving are essential soft skills for navigating complex data integration tasks. These skills ensure accurate, efficient, and reliable data movement and transformation, which are critical for supporting business intelligence and decision-making.

What are some common challenges ETL database developers face when managing large-scale data integrations?

ETL Database Developers often encounter challenges such as optimizing data pipelines for performance, handling inconsistent or incomplete source data, and ensuring data security during transfers. Additionally, coordinating with data source owners and downstream users requires strong communication skills to address changing requirements or resolve data discrepancies. Staying up to date with evolving ETL tools and best practices is also essential for maintaining efficient and reliable data processes.

What is the difference between Etl Database Developer vs Data Warehouse Developer?

AspectEtl Database DeveloperData Warehouse Developer
Primary FocusDesigning and implementing ETL processes to move and transform dataDesigning and developing data warehouse architectures and schemas
Skills & CertificationsSQL, ETL tools, database management, certifications like Microsoft Certified: Data Analyst AssociateData modeling, SQL, ETL, certifications like Certified Data Management Professional
Work EnvironmentData integration teams, BI projects, enterprise data systemsData warehousing projects, analytics teams, business intelligence environments

While both roles involve working with data and ETL processes, the Etl Database Developer primarily focuses on creating and maintaining ETL pipelines to ensure data flows correctly between systems. The Data Warehouse Developer concentrates on designing the overall data warehouse structure to support analytics and reporting. Both roles often collaborate but serve different aspects of data management and analytics infrastructure.
